Ok, so my mandarin ducks started laying eggs, and there is currently 9 eggs in there, I have 4 pairs (1 white pair) of mandarin ducks and I believe 2 are laying in the same box.
Question 1
So... I am debating on taking 8 of the eggs and hatching them myself, and see if they will lay another clutch.
And should I take them all once there is 10 (probably tomorrow) or leave 2 to encourage more laying?
Question 2
Any suggestions for increasing the hatch rate of these non domestic ducks?
Currently, I am going for the 99.5°, 65% humidity from day 1-25, and 75% humidity from 25-28.
I also heard of a thing where you spray them with same temperature water every other day from days 10-25 that I am going to try.
